About The Author

Paul Merson

Paul Merson was born in Harlesden in March 1968.

He made his debut for Arsenal in 1986, and in a 12-year stint at Highbury he won the First Division twice, the FA Cup, the League Cup and the European Cup Winners’ Cup. He also won 21 caps for England.

Merson went on to play for Middlesbrough, Aston Villa and Portsmouth, as well as Walsall - where he was also manager.

Following retirement in 2006, Merson has become a high-profile football pundit for Sky Sports. He is a long-serving member of the team on Soccer Saturday, the iconic results show, and also writes a regular column for the Daily Star newspaper.
